Latest On Investment Brokerage: List Of Investment Brokerage In Rally Mode (SMA50 Vs SMA200) (Dec-18) 0 comments
Screen Criteria:
List of Investment Brokerage stocks, with the 50-day simple moving average (SMA50) trading above the 200-day simple moving average (SMA200). (Link to original post)
Ranking of This List:
This list is currently ranked 157 out of 284 lists tracked by Contextuall.com, i.e. the company characteristics described below have outperformed 44.72% of lists in Contextuall's coverage universe.
Average Weekly Returns:
Average 1-Week Return of All Stocks Mentioned Below: 3.29%
Average 1-Month Return of All Stocks Mentioned Below: 5.10%
Analysis of List Alpha:
Number of Stocks in This List Generating Excess Return vs. SP500 (Beta Adjusted Over Last Week): 4 out of 5 (80.0%)
Number of Stocks in This List Generating Excess Return vs. SP500 (Beta Adjusted Over Last Month): 2 out of 5 (40.0%)
(List sorted by monthly performance, from best to worst)
1. Morgan Stanley (MS): Provides various financial products and services to corporations, governments, financial institutions, and individuals worldwide. 50-day SMA at 17.14 vs. 200-day SMA at 16.03 (current price at 19.12).
2. The Charles Schwab Corporation (SCHW): Provides securities brokerage, banking, and related financial services to individuals and institutional clients. 50-day SMA at 13.22 vs. 200-day SMA at 13.20 (current price at 14.21).
3. Raymond James Financial Inc. (RJF): Engages in the underwriting, distribution, trading, and brokerage of equity and debt securities, as well as the sale of mutual funds and other investment products in the United States, Canada, and Europe. 50-day SMA at 37.56 vs. 200-day SMA at 35.55 (current price at 39.42).
4. Jefferies Group (JEF): Operates as a securities and investment banking company in the Americas, Europe, and Asia. 50-day SMA at 15.71 vs. 200-day SMA at 14.87 (current price at 18.8).
5. CME Group Inc. (CME): Operates the CME, CBOT, NYMEX, and COMEX regulatory exchanges worldwide. 50-day SMA at 54.88 vs. 200-day SMA at 53.88 (current price at 52.41).
